What is Sponsorship?
Sponsors are Kingdom-minded businesses and business leaders who partner with Barnabas Bay Area to help strengthen the bridge between the marketplace and ministry.
While Partners engage as individuals and couples, Sponsors invest at an organizational level - helping expand our reach, support ministry engagement, and create opportunities for more business and ministry leaders to connect around a shared Kingdom purpose.

Partner Units
A Partnership Unit represents one Barnabas partner (or couple) within the chapter and includes:
Attendance at four main Barnabas Summits per year
Access to additional non-formal networking events
Participation in ministry project opportunities
Community and marketplace collaboration with other partners
All Barnabas Bay Area partnership benefits
A typical stand-alone partnership is $1,800 per year.
